What is Karbolyn?
Karbolyn is a branded carbohydrate supplement known for its unique structure and rapid absorption. It is a homopolysaccharide, which is a relatively complex carbohydrate composed of many monosaccharide units linked together. Karbolyn is derived from natural, food-based sources, including potato, rice, and corn, and is processed using a patented multi-stage 'Enzymatic Milling Process' to create an optimal molecular size. This unique molecular size is what allows it to be absorbed quickly by the body while still offering the sustained energy typically associated with more complex carbohydrates. It is also marketed as being 100% sugar-free, gluten-free, and vegan-friendly.
How Karbolyn Works for Performance
For athletes, the ability to quickly replenish muscle glycogen is crucial for sustaining performance and speeding up recovery. Karbolyn is engineered to move through the stomach rapidly, even faster than simple sugars like dextrose. This accelerated gastric emptying means it gets into the bloodstream quickly, delivering fuel to the muscles with minimal digestive discomfort like bloating or cramping. By providing a fast yet sustained release of energy, Karbolyn helps prevent the significant insulin spikes and subsequent crashes that can occur with simple sugars. This mechanism makes it a versatile fuel source, suitable for use before, during, and after a workout session.
Usage recommendations for optimal results include:
- Pre-Workout: Consuming Karbolyn about 30-60 minutes before training to maximize muscle fuel availability and enhance performance.
- Intra-Workout: Sipping on it during prolonged, intense exercise to maintain energy levels and prevent fatigue.
- Post-Workout: Taking it immediately after a workout to rapidly replenish depleted muscle glycogen stores and promote faster recovery.
The Health Context: Is Karbolyn Truly Healthy?
To determine whether Karbolyn is 'healthy', it's important to view it in context. For the purpose it was designed—as a performance fuel for athletes—it can be considered a healthy choice, particularly when compared to alternatives filled with simple sugars. However, for the average person not engaged in high-intensity training, the answer is more nuanced. As a highly processed carbohydrate, it lacks the broader nutritional benefits found in whole food sources, such as fiber, vitamins, and minerals. A nutritionist's take suggests that while it is an effective tool for targeted energy, it should always be balanced within a diet rich in whole foods.
Potential Downsides and Considerations
While generally well-tolerated, some individuals have reported side effects, most notably stomach issues. For those with specific carbohydrate sensitivities or blood sugar management concerns, such as pre-diabetics or diabetics, caution is advised. Although some studies have shown potential benefits for pre-diabetic glucose control during exercise, further research is needed, and medical advice is always recommended.
Comparison: Karbolyn vs. Other Carbohydrates
Karbolyn's unique properties are best understood when compared to other common carbohydrate sources used in sports nutrition. The following table highlights the key differences.
| Feature | Karbolyn | Dextrose/Simple Sugars | Maltodextrin | Whole Food Carbs (e.g., Oats) |
|---|---|---|---|---|
| Absorption Speed | Very Fast | Very Fast | Fast | Slow/Moderate |
| Energy Profile | Sustained Release | Quick Spike & Crash | Quick Spike & Moderate Fall | Slow & Steady Release |
| Sugar Content | Sugar-Free | 100% Sugar | Sugar-Free | Natural Sugars (low GI) |
| Digestive Impact | Low Bloating/Cramping | Possible Digestive Distress | Less Bloating than Dextrose | Minimal Digestive Distress |
| Nutrient Density | Low (Fuel Source Only) | Low | Low | High (Fiber, Vitamins, Minerals) |
| Best For | Pre/Intra/Post-Workout | Immediate Energy | Intra-Workout Fueling | General Health & Sustained Energy |
Expert Opinions and Clinical Studies
Karbolyn has been the subject of clinical research, including a study examining its effects on blood glucose levels. In one study, participants consumed either Karbolyn or a glucose placebo during light aerobic activity. The results suggested that Karbolyn provided a smoother, more stable blood glucose response compared to the sharp spike and crash seen with pure glucose. Interestingly, pre-diabetic volunteers showed a more controlled glucose utilization curve with Karbolyn, behaving more like the normal individuals in the study. While these findings are promising, they underscore the need for more extensive, independent research, and highlight that Karbolyn primarily serves a specific performance purpose rather than broad nutritional health.
